Start with the workflow, not the tool.

The assessment looks at the source material, manual review path, security boundary, and output format before recommending a build.
01

Source Material

Which files, data rooms, evidence sets, exports, policies, contracts, or ERP tables does the workflow depend on?

02

Manual Review Path

Who prepares the first pass, who checks it, what errors matter, and where do senior reviewers lose time?

03

Security Governance

What data sensitivity, access rules, deployment boundaries, retention requirements, and audit expectations apply?

04

Output Fit

What should the system produce: issue list, workpaper draft, evidence queue, SQL-backed answer, memo, or dashboard?
